/**
2015-09-10 12:56:29 +00:00
* Returns a synopsis of the blockchain used for syncing . This consists of a list of
* block hashes at intervals exponentially increasing towards the genesis block .
* When syncing to a peer , the peer uses this data to determine if we ' re on the same
* fork as they are , and if not , what blocks they need to send us to get us on their
* fork .
*
* In the over - simplified case , this is a straighforward synopsis of our current
* preferred blockchain ; when we first connect up to a peer , this is what we will be sending .
* It looks like this :
* If the blockchain is empty , it will return the empty list .
* If the blockchain has one block , it will return a list containing just that block .
* If it contains more than one block :
* the first element in the list will be the hash of the highest numbered block that
* we cannot undo
* the second element will be the hash of an item at the half way point in the undoable
* segment of the blockchain
* the third will be ~ 3 / 4 of the way through the undoable segment of the block chain
* the fourth will be at ~ 7 / 8. . .
* & c .
* the last item in the list will be the hash of the most recent block on our preferred chain
* so if the blockchain had 26 blocks labeled a - z , the synopsis would be :
* a n u x z
* the idea being that by sending a small ( < 30 ) number of block ids , we can summarize a huge
* blockchain . The block ids are more dense near the end of the chain where because we are
* more likely to be almost in sync when we first connect , and forks are likely to be short .
* If the peer we ' re syncing with in our example is on a fork that started at block ' v ' ,
* then they will reply to our synopsis with a list of all blocks starting from block ' u ' ,
* the last block they know that we had in common .
*
* In the real code , there are several complications .
*
* First , as an optimization , we don ' t usually send a synopsis of the entire blockchain , we
* send a synopsis of only the segment of the blockchain that we have undo data for . If their
* fork doesn ' t build off of something in our undo history , we would be unable to switch , so there ' s
* no reason to fetch the blocks .

*
2015-09-10 12:56:29 +00:00
* Second , when a peer replies to our initial synopsis and gives us a list of the blocks they think
* we are missing , they only send a chunk of a few thousand blocks at once . After we get those
* block ids , we need to request more blocks by sending another synopsis ( we can ' t just say " send me
* the next 2000 ids " because they may have switched forks themselves and they don't track what
* they ' ve sent us ) . For faster performance , we want to get a fairly long list of block ids first ,
* then start downloading the blocks .
* The peer doesn ' t handle these follow - up block id requests any different from the initial request ;
* it treats the synopsis we send as our blockchain and bases its response entirely off that . So to
* get the response we want ( the next chunk of block ids following the last one they sent us , or ,
* failing that , the shortest fork off of the last list of block ids they sent ) , we need to construct
* a synopsis as if our blockchain was made up of :
* 1. the blocks in our block chain up to the fork point ( if there is a fork ) or the head block ( if no fork )
* 2. the blocks we ' ve already pushed from their fork ( if there ' s a fork )
* 3. the block ids they ' ve previously sent us
* Segment 3 is handled in the p2p code , it just tells us the number of blocks it has ( in
* number_of_blocks_after_reference_point ) so we can leave space in the synopsis for them .
* We ' re responsible for constructing the synopsis of Segments 1 and 2 from our active blockchain and
* fork database . The reference_point parameter is the last block from that peer that has been
* successfully pushed to the blockchain , so that tells us whether the peer is on a fork or on
* the main chain .
